Worcester Cathedral has been a place of Christian worship and prayer for fourteen centuries, and is the burial place of both King John and Prince Arthur Tudor. The present building was begun in 1084 and is dedicated to Christ and the Blessed Virgin Mary.

Cathedral in city centre. No entry fee, donation accepted. Beautiful large cathedral with stained glass windows and high ceiling. Basement crypt viewable. Accessible medium sized garden into the middle of the cathedral. Tour guides and Tower walks available at certain times.
